Rodriguez, Mendoza plan June wedding


Margarita Rodriguez and Fidel Mendoza will marry on June 6,
at Our Lady of Mt. Carmel Catholic Church in El Paso.

The bride-elect is the daughter of Jesus B. Rodgriguez and
Carmen Rodriguez of El Paso.

The prospective bridegroom formerly of Pecos, now residing
in San Angelo is the son of Mr. and Mrs. Marcos Mendoza Sr.
of Pecos.

Rodriguez is a 1982 graduate of Ysleta High School. She
received a bachelor's degree in interdisciplinary studies at
the University of Texas El Paso.

She is currently a title/support teacher in El Paso.

Her fiance is a 1976 graduate of Pecos High School. He
attended Odessa College and currently works for GTE Phone
company in San Angelo.

Mellard completes program


Twenty-one students have successfully completed Clarendon
College's Ranch and Feedlot Operations Program, according to
RFO Director Jerry Gage, including one Balmorhea resident.

Damon K. Mellard, of Balmorhea, was one of the members of
the class of 1998.

Graduation ceremonies were held April 24 in the Harned
Sisters Fine Arts Auditorium at Clarendon College. Mr. Neal
Odom with the McLean Feedyard in McLean was the featured
speaker.

Established in 1974, the CC Ranch and Feedlot Operations
Program allows students who are interested in ranch or
feedlot-related careers to gain new knowledge and technical
skills to meet the needs of today's complex agricultural
problems. RFO students must complete academic coursework, as
well as, extensive field work conducted on ranched and
feedyards. It is not unusual for an RFO graduate to have
logged 8,000 miles across Texas, Oklahoma, New Mexico and
other states visiting top ranches, feedyards and
agricultural centers.

A public community college, Clarendon College is located in
Clarendon, Tx. The college was founded in 1898 and will
begin celebrating its Centennial Birthday on Sept. 5.
Clarendon College offers 35 majors and five workforce
education programs through campuses in Clarendon, Pampa,
Wellington, Childress and Shamrock.
